linux中sz命令
时间: 2024-06-17 15:03:15 浏览: 119
linux中rz上传、sz下载命令详解
5星 · 资源好评率100%
在Linux中,`sz`命令用于解压缩归档文件(通常为tar文件)。它属于`binutils`软件包的一部分,通常在大多数Linux发行版中预装。
`sz`命令的功能类似于Windows系统中的`tar`命令,但它是在命令行界面下使用的,而不是在图形界面中。它可以将压缩文件解压缩到当前目录中,或者将其提取到指定的目录中。
下面是`sz`命令的一些常用选项和用法:
```css
sz [options] filename
```
常见选项包括:
* `-d`:解压缩文件。
* `-x`:提取文件。
* `-f`:指定归档文件的路径和名称。
* `-v`:显示详细信息,包括解压缩或提取的进度。
* `-l`:显示归档文件的列表。
* `-r`:递归地解压缩或提取目录及其内容。
使用示例:
1. 解压缩文件:
```bash
sz filename.tar.gz
```
这会将`filename.tar.gz`文件解压缩到当前目录中。
2. 提取文件到指定目录:
```bash
sz -x filename.tar.gz /path/to/extract/directory
```
这会将`filename.tar.gz`文件提取到指定的目录中。
3. 显示归档文件的列表:
```bash
sz -l archive_file.tar
```
这会显示归档文件`archive_file.tar`的内容列表。
4. 递归解压缩目录及其内容:
```bash
sz -r archive_dir/
```
这会将包含归档文件的目录及其内容解压缩到当前目录中。
请注意,使用`sz`命令需要安装`binutils`软件包,并在终端中以root或具有适当权限的用户身份运行该命令。此外,某些Linux发行版可能使用不同的软件包名称或路径,请根据您的系统配置进行相应调整。
阅读全文